Job Description:

The Benefits Specialist will support the administration of employee benefit programs by managing enrollments, billing, reporting, payroll deductions, and employee inquiries. The ideal candidate is highly detail-oriented, comfortable working with data, and eager to identify opportunities to improve processes while providing outstanding internal customer service.


Key Responsibilities:
  • Administer employee benefit enrollments, life event changes, and eligibility updates.
  • Review and reconcile monthly benefit invoices, researching and resolving discrepancies.
  • Audit payroll benefit deductions to ensure accuracy and coordinate corrections with Payroll when necessary.
  • Respond to employee questions regarding benefit plans, enrollment, documentation, deadlines, and coverage.
  • Generate reports and maintain accurate records using ADP Workforce Now and other HR systems.
  • Update and maintain SharePoint resources, benefit communications, and internal documentation.
  • Conduct routine audits to ensure compliance with benefit plan requirements and company policies.
  • Support Open Enrollment and year-end benefits initiatives.
  • Coordinate with benefit vendors and internal departments to resolve administrative issues.
  • Recommend process improvements and contribute ideas to enhance the team's efficiency.
